Chevy Corsica Running Hot?

Q. Hi Vince, I have a question for you. My temperature guage fluctuates from its normal ¼ to ½ but it jumps up and down erradically. Is there a cause for this I replaced the water pump, but did not flush the system just blew out the coolant and replaced with new 50/50 coolant.

1991 Chevy Corsica
2.2 liter 4 cylinder
Automatic transmission
260 000 kms
Fuel Injection
no-ABS brakes
P/S - A/C
power steering

I am thinking my temperature sensor is going. What is the normal operating temperature of a four cylinder engine? My guage has 25° - 125°; I am assuming it is in Celsius since I am in Canada. My friends Caravan also has a bouncy temperature guage, It is a V-6 auto and recently had the water pump done too.

Thanks for your reply, your a godsend for us poor working stiffs who have to fix their own car.

A. You may have air trapped in the system somewhere. These cars run around 200° F (93° C). The coolant fan will not come on until it hits 228° F (109° C).
